Appsecure logo

CVE-2022-4147: High Vulnerability in Quarkus

CVE-2022-4147 is a high-severity vulnerability in Quarkus that allows unauthorized requests through its CORS filter. Organizations must address this issue promptly to mitigate potential risks.

HIGHCVSS 7.5 · Published December 6, 2022

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

CVE-2022-4147 is a high-severity vulnerability affecting the Quarkus framework. This vulnerability allows simple GET and POST requests with invalid Origin headers to proceed, potentially leading to unauthorized access to sensitive resources. The assessed CVSS score for this vulnerability is 7.5, indicating a high level of concern that organizations must address to safeguard their applications.

The risk to organizations includes the possibility of unauthorized actions being performed on behalf of legitimate users, which can lead to significant data breaches or service disruptions. The vulnerability impacts applications that utilize Quarkus for handling CORS, making it essential for developers and security teams to prioritize remediation efforts.

Currently, there is no known exploit publicly available for this vulnerability, but the potential impact remains substantial. Organizations should prioritize patching immediately to prevent exploitation.

The vulnerability was published on December 6, 2022, and has been classified as modified in the CVE database. It is crucial for organizations utilizing Quarkus to assess their exposure and implement necessary updates promptly.

Vulnerability Details

According to the CVE description, the Quarkus CORS filter permits simple GET and POST requests with invalid Origin headers. These requests, made using XMLHttpRequest without registered event listeners or ReadableStream objects, can allow unauthorized actions to be executed.

This vulnerability falls under the CWE-1026 classification, indicating a weakness in the design of the CORS filter. Organizations should be aware of the potential risks associated with the configuration and design of their web applications.

The CVSS score of 7.5 reflects the high impact this vulnerability can have on confidentiality, integrity, and availability. The attack vector is classified as network-based, and the attack complexity is high, requiring user interaction. This means that while the vulnerability is serious, exploiting it may not be straightforward.

Technical Analysis

The root cause of this vulnerability lies in the implementation of the CORS filter in Quarkus. Attackers may leverage this flaw to bypass security measures intended to prevent unauthorized access to resources. The attack vector is primarily network-based, allowing remote attackers to exploit vulnerable configurations.

Given that the attack complexity is high and user interaction is required, attackers must convince users to perform specific actions, such as clicking on malicious links or executing scripts designed to exploit the vulnerability.

The confidentiality, integrity, and availability impacts are assessed as high, indicating that successful exploitation can lead to significant data exposure and unauthorized modifications, potentially affecting the availability of the application.

Risk & Impact Analysis

Real-world deployment of this vulnerability poses a serious risk, especially for organizations using Quarkus in environments where sensitive data is accessible. The potential blast radius is substantial due to the widespread use of web applications leveraging CORS for cross-origin requests.

Organizations should address this vulnerability in their priority patch cycle to mitigate risks associated with unauthorized access and data breaches. Given the high CVSS score, the urgency for remediation is critical.

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

The affected versions of Quarkus are those from 2.0 up to, but not including, 2.13.5, as well as from 2.14.0 up to, but not including, 2.14.2. Organizations must ensure their deployments are updated to these versions or later to mitigate this vulnerability.

Mitigation & Remediation

To mitigate this vulnerability, organizations should prioritize patching their Quarkus installations to the latest versions that address this issue. Upgrading to a fixed version is essential, and organizations can find more information on how to implement these patches through application security assessments and related documentation.

Detection Guidance

Organizations should monitor their applications for any unusual behavior that may indicate exploitation attempts. Log indicators such as access from unexpected origins, changes in request patterns, and unauthorized access attempts should be reviewed regularly. Additionally, behavioral anomalies should be analyzed to identify potential security incidents.

AppSecure Threat Intelligence Insight

In analyzing the long-term significance of CVE-2022-4147, it is evident that vulnerabilities in widely used frameworks like Quarkus can lead to severe security incidents if not addressed promptly. This incident underscores the importance of implementing rigorous security assessments as part of the development lifecycle.

Organizations are encouraged to learn from this vulnerability and implement robust security practices, including regular patching and security testing. Security teams should consider adopting penetration testing services to continuously evaluate their security posture.

Additionally, understanding the context of this vulnerability can help organizations develop better defensive strategies. The trend of CORS-related vulnerabilities indicates a need for enhanced security measures in web application design, particularly concerning cross-origin requests.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.